The value of
Power Predictability

Power failures in the US and Europe have a substantial economic impact, costing society an estimated 100-125 billion euros annually.

In 2019, power outages in Norway resulted in an interruption cost of over one billion NOK, with 45% of this amount attributed to natural causes such as ice, snow, wind, and vegetation.

Inspections and improvements of lines currently make up to 40% of operating costs for power companies in both the US and Europe.

In 2021, power companies in Norway took an average of 1 hour and 18 minutes to resolve each power outage.

Approximately 54% of customers in Norway experienced long-term power outages in 2021, highlighting the significant impact on electricity service reliability.

In 2021, major power outages affected over 350 million people worldwide, accounting for more than 4% of the global population.

In 2021, approximately 38% of customers in Norway encountered short-term power outages, reflecting the prevalence of brief disruptions in electricity supply.
